the importance of movement

Physical Health Benefits

  1. Improves Heart Health – Regular movement strengthens the heart, lowers blood pressure, and reduces the risk of heart disease.

  2. Boosts Metabolism & Weight Management – Helps burn calories, build muscle, and maintain a healthy weight.

  3. Enhances Strength & Flexibility – Reduces stiffness, improves mobility, and lowers the risk of injury.

  4. Strengthens Bones & Joints – Weight-bearing exercises help prevent osteoporosis and joint pain.

  5. Supports Immune Function – Regular activity can help the body fight infections and reduce inflammation.

Mental & Emotional Well-Being

  1. Reduces Stress & Anxiety – Physical activity releases endorphins, which improve mood and reduce stress.

  2. Enhances Brain Function – Improves memory, focus, and cognitive function, reducing the risk of dementia.

  3. Boosts Energy Levels – Increases oxygen flow and reduces fatigue, making you feel more alert.

  4. Improves Sleep – Helps regulate sleep patterns, leading to deeper, more restful sleep.

Long-Term Health Benefits

  1. Lowers Risk of Chronic Diseases – Reduces the likelihood of diabetes, stroke, and some cancers.

  2. Increases Longevity – Regular movement is linked to a longer, healthier life.

  3. Enhances Quality of Life – Improves overall well-being, confidence, and ability to perform daily tasks.

Even simple activities like walking, stretching, yoga, or dancing can provide these benefits. The key is consistency—moving a little each day adds up to big health rewards!
